Ruffwear Grip Trex Dog Boots
Pros
- ✓Vibram outsole gives genuine grip on rock, scree, and wet roots — the only boot in this lineup with technical hiking traction
- ✓Breathable mesh upper with hook-and-loop instep closure stays on through running, biking, and creek crossings
- ✓Reflective trim for low-light hikes
- ✓4.2 stars across 2,376 reviews from active outdoor owners
Cons
- ✗$37+ per pair (sold as pair, not single boot) — full set runs $75+
- ✗Sizing requires measuring paw width in inches; runs narrow for wide-pawed retrievers
Ruffwear Sun Shower Dog Raincoat
Pros
- ✓Lightweight non-insulated waterproof and windproof shell — the right answer when the goal is keeping a wet dog dry, not adding warmth
- ✓Full-coverage cut protects chest, back, and rear from rain spray
- ✓Reflective trim and leash port for harness compatibility
- ✓4.6 stars across 894 reviews from rain-belt owners
Cons
- ✗Not insulated — pair with a Hurtta or Carhartt underneath for cold-rain combinations
- ✗List price $74.99 — current sale at $56 is decent but not bargain-bin
